Kyle Banner is a 26-year-old football player who plays as a center back for Stirling Albion, born on 13 luglio 1999, who is right-footed. In the 2025/2026 League Two season, Kyle Banner has recorded 0 goals, 2 assists, 2745 minutes, 5 yellow cards.

Kyle Banner scores highly on Assists and Minutes compared to center backs in the League Two.
